Sooner Kia in Oklahoma City: Kia Inventory and Service on the North Side

Sooner Kia is a franchise dealership carrying new and certified pre-owned Kia vehicles, located on the north side of Oklahoma City. The lot focuses on volume retail for Kia's compact and mid-size sedan and SUV lines, with an attached service department handling warranty work, routine maintenance, and repairs for Kia owners throughout the metro area.

New and Certified Pre-Owned Kia Stock

Sooner Kia stocks new Kias across the current lineup: the Forte and K5 sedans, the Niro and Sportage crossovers, and the Telluride three-row SUV. Certified pre-owned (CPO) inventory rotates but typically includes vehicles aged one to five years with under 60,000 miles, each backed by Kia's 10-year/100,000-mile powertrain CPO warranty. New vehicle pricing aligns with Kia's national MSRP; a 2024 Forte EX sedan starts near $23,000 before negotiation and incentives, while a Telluride EX begins around $44,000. CPO pricing runs 10 to 15 percent below equivalent new models, depending on mileage and year. Confirm current inventory and pricing before visiting, as stock and incentive programs shift monthly.

Service Department Hours and Capabilities

The service department operates Monday through Friday, 7 a.m. to 6 p.m., and Saturday 8 a.m. to 3 p.m.; it closes Sundays. Oil changes run $35 to $50 depending on synthetic versus conventional. Tire rotations cost $25. Brake pad replacement ranges from $150 to $300 per axle, and transmission fluid service runs $120 to $180. The shop handles warranty claims, recalls, and general maintenance without surcharge for in-warranty work. Most routine services can be scheduled online or by phone; walk-in maintenance is accepted if capacity allows, but morning appointments fill quickly during weekdays.

How Sooner Kia Compares to Other Oklahoma City Kia Dealers

Kia has two primary dealerships in Oklahoma City: Sooner Kia on the north side and Kia of Oklahoma City on the south side near I-40. Both carry identical factory stock and honor the same Kia warranty, but they differ in service convenience. Sooner Kia's north location serves drivers from Edmond, Bethany, and northwest Oklahoma City more directly; Kia of Oklahoma City suits south-metro and I-40 corridor shoppers better. Service turnaround and appointment availability are similar at both, though Sooner Kia's Saturday hours (8 a.m. to 3 p.m.) make weekend maintenance more accessible than the south dealership's Saturday-morning-only window. For new buyers, visit whichever location is nearer; for CPO shoppers, call both to compare available inventory before driving.
